Suddenly, time stood still. “Almost ten minutes, from 1:30 p.m. to 1:39 p.m.,” says Emma, in her twenties. The corridors of Paris-Dauphine University were packed to the rafters. Not a sound, or almost. “There were a lot of people, all the way to the 4th floor,” the young woman continues. Like her, hundreds of students and teachers paid tribute on Monday to Philippine Le Noir de Carlan, whose body was discovered on Saturday a few hundred meters away, in the Bois de Boulogne.
On a table on the 3rd floor, flowers were placed in front of a photo of the victim, aged 19, who was enrolled in the 3rd year of a degree in economics and financial engineering. Students can leave a message or a testimony in one of the two notebooks provided for this purpose. “We didn’t know her, she wasn’t in our class, but it breaks my heart, especially since she was found next door to here,” adds Emma.
“She was coming out of the canteen and she got killed”
“There was a huge traffic jam on the stairs. All the teachers were there. It was quite an emotional moment. We are sad and shocked,” says Charlotte, in her twenties. Since the announcement of Philippine’s death, “everyone is a bit freaked out,” she says. “It could happen to anyone at the university,” adds Arthur, also a student at the university. “She was coming out of the canteen and she was killed, it’s shocking.”
The body of Philippine Le Noir de Carlan was discovered on Saturday, shortly before 5 p.m., on the other side of the ring road, on the edge of the Bois de Boulogne. The day before, she had lunch at the Crous around 2 p.m. Originally from Montigny-le-Bretonneux, in the Yvelines, the young woman was then due to go to her parents for the weekend. But she never got on the RER C. Without news, her family tried several times to contact her on her mobile. In vain.

So her sister went to the police station in the 16th arrondissement of Paris on Friday evening, around 11pm, to report this worrying disappearance. The next day, her relatives organised a search, bringing together around fifty participants. While trying to geolocate her mobile phone, one of them ended up discovering the victim’s body, partially buried: a knee and an arm were sticking out of the ground.
According to our information, the forensic officers found numerous traces of abuse and injuries on the victim. An autopsy still had to be carried out to determine the causes of the young woman’s death.
The Paris prosecutor’s office, which has opened an investigation for voluntary homicide, has contacted the criminal brigade of the judicial police. The police officers quickly interviewed the witnesses. Because if no surveillance camera is installed in this wooded area, the sector is far from deserted. It is frequented by joggers, local residents walking their dogs. And the Neuneu festival, which attracts thousands of visitors, has set up shop not far from there.
Masked suspect with pickaxe
Several witnesses, including a fairground security guard, reported seeing a man wearing a surgical mask heading towards the lower lake, a pickaxe in his hand. On Monday, investigators were combing the area for any clues that might put them on the suspect’s trail. They were meticulously inspecting the footbridge that overlooks the ring road. Philippine and her murderer probably passed along this small gravel path that connects the capital to its woods.
The bridge is located right across from Claude-Debussy Square and… the Russian Embassy. Will the police ask to see the footage captured by the surveillance cameras installed on the building?
At this stage of the investigation, no suspects have been arrested. Dauphine management has reinforced security measures at the entrance to the establishment and set up a psychological unit to help students and staff who may need it.
